| Notes |
- DISTINCTION: Esquire.
LIVING: He swore fealty to the Black Prince 1343. (Bartrum, Welsh Genealogies 300-1400, vol. 4 p. 178)
RESIDENCE: Glyn Aeron. (Evans, British Genealogist, book 8 p. H2)
RESIDENCE: Glynayron. (Thomas, Golden Grove MS, book 13 p. K1519)
- (Research):KINSHIP: Conflict/Error> Dwnn's 'Heraldic Visitations of Wales' volume 1 page 18 calls him Ieuan "Llwyd" ap Ieuan ap Gruffudd "Foel" ap [omits a generation called Gruffudd] [calls this generation Ifor instead of Iorwerth ap] Cydifor.
KINSHIP: Conflict/Error> Dwnn's 'Heraldic Visitations of Wales' volume 2 page 24 calls him Ieuan "Llwyd" ap Gruffudd "Foel" ab Iorwerth ap Cadwgon ap Gwaithfoed.
KINSHIP: Conflict/Error> 'Golden Grove MSS' book 19 page 10 gives him a son William, but his identity is probably Cadwgon or Llywelyn.
KINSHIP: Conflict/Error> Evans' 'British Genealogist' book 7 page G38 gives him a son named William.
